What is Inbox Placement?

Test whether your emails land in the inbox, spam folder, or nowhere at all.

Inbox Placement tells you where your emails actually land — inbox, spam folder, or missing. Unlike validation (which checks whether an address exists), inbox placement checks whether your sending infrastructure and domain reputation are good enough to reach the inbox.

What affects inbox placement

  • Your sending domain's SPF, DMARC, and DKIM configuration
  • Your domain and IP reputation with each provider
  • The content of your test email
  • Whether you've recently sent high volumes of email

Inbox Placement vs. Email Validation

Validation checks the recipient's email address. Inbox placement checks your sender reputation. Both matter — you can have a perfect list of valid addresses and still land in spam if your sending domain has poor reputation.
